Tux's Story

Meet Tux (aka Tuxalily or Mr. Lily) — a resilient, soulful boy finally ready for the safe, loving home he’s always deserved.<br/><br/>Tux spent years as a clever, street‑smart tomcat who managed to avoid the trap for more than 18 months. Even so, he slowly warmed up to the volunteer caring for his colony, revealing a sweet, gentle personality beneath his cautious exterior. When he eventually showed up sick and injured in July 2025, it became clear it was time to bring him inside for good.<br/><br/>Since then, Tux has healed beautifully. He’s now neutered, vaccinated, microchipped, parasite‑treated, and enjoying the comfort of indoor life while he decompresses from his time outdoors. He’s discovered some new favorite things too — wet food, gentle pets, play time, and relaxing on the couch in the same room as his favorite people.<br/><br/>Tux thrives in a quiet, calm home. He can become overstimulated, so loud environments, small children, and dogs aren’t a good match. In stressful moments he may hiss or swat, so he needs adopters who can read his cues and give him space when he asks for it.<br/><br/>He’ll also need high‑quality, sensitive‑stomach food to keep him feeling his best. Tux is FIV+, but it doesn’t slow him down — he loves the company of other cats and would enjoy a friendly feline companion. Dogs, however, are a firm no for him.<br/><br/>Tux is a survivor with a tender heart who has waited a long time for the right people. If you can offer a peaceful home where he can truly relax and feel safe, he may be your perfect match.<br/><br/>You can apply here: https://www.scratchinc.org/adoption.
